Johnny Depp to star in film on Dante
December 4th, 2008 - 9:25 pm ICT by IANS
London, Dec 4 (IANS) Hollywood superstar Johnny Depp will star in a film based on the life of Italian Renaissance poet Dante.Depp’s production company, Infinitum Nihil, has bought the screen rights to Nick Tosches’ 2002 book, “In The Hand of Dante” on which the film will be based, reports contactmusic.com.
The story will parallel the lives of a modern-day writer, played by Depp, and Dante as he attempts to complete his classic work “The Divine Comedy”.
The lead has not been decided yet.
